find four consecutive integers such that the sum of the second and the fourth is seventeen less than thrice the first.

consecutive integers: x, (x+1), (x+2), (x+3)
(x+1) + (x+3) = 3x - 17
2x + 4 = 3x - 17
21 = x
The integers are 21, 22, 23, and 24.
